Digital Desk: In the Pilibhit area of Uttar Pradesh, two girls allegedly committed suicide by consuming poison on Sunday after a fight between their parents, police said.

The incident took place in the Puranpur police station area.

Circle Kashish (20) and Munni (18), daughters of local corporator Asim Raza, consumed poison on Sunday night, according to area officer Alok Singh. They were transferred to the local hospital, where they died while receiving treatment.

Their parents used to argue frequently over family matters, according to the police. On Sunday they also got into one of these fights. Their daughters were tired of this and thus, took the extreme step, police said.

The family first refused to allow the police to intervene in the case.

According to the CO, more police were stationed in the vicinity and the remains were transferred for post-mortem examination.
